/**
 * Resource for creating an AWS CodeDeploy service. This resource uses the config-as-code API's. When updating the `name` or `path` of this resource you should typically also set the `createBeforeDestroy = true` lifecycle setting.
 *
 * ## Example Usage
 *
 * ```typescript
 * import * as pulumi from "@pulumi/pulumi";
 * import * as harness from "@lbrlabs/pulumi-harness";
 *
 * const exampleApplication = new harness.Application("exampleApplication", {});
 * const exampleCodedeploy = new harness.service.Codedeploy("exampleCodedeploy", {
 *     appId: exampleApplication.id,
 *     description: "Service for AWS codedeploy applications.",
 * });
 * ```
 *
 * ## Import
 *
 * Import using the Harness application id and service id
 *
 * ```sh
 *  $ pulumi import harness:service/codedeploy:Codedeploy example <app_id>/<svc_id>
 * ```
 */
